Output 261e07333659747dc84d62b952e35f45609ffa1638fb466da49590aede118a75:58

value
89109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1399de6287842f8e621c5dbf1f953cd1371cee OP_EQUAL
address
3K23ntwX8DutEwt1D8V8TUF2srApKrhJSr
transaction
261e07333659747dc84d62b952e35f45609ffa1638fb466da49590aede118a75
spent
true